Published by the Hertfordshire Record Society, 1987, 1st edition. Hertfordshire Record Publications, volume three. Maroon cloth boards, gilt lettering to spine under white dustwrapper illustrated with maps. 9.75ins x 6.25ins, xiv, 127pp plus frontis. Illustrations within the text. This book derives from the manuscript notes and comments that Cussans entered into his own copy of his History of Hertfordshire. Dw has minor creasing to rear cover. VG /G+.
